  • Idaho Investigation - The DNA Trail and the White Elantra
    Mar 29 2026
    AI host Raven Thorne examines the forensic evidence that led to Bryan Kohberger's conviction in the Idaho student murders: touch DNA on a knife sheath, surveillance footage of a white Elantra circling the victims' home, strategic cellphone silence, and familial DNA recovered from discarded trash. The episode traces how investigators assembled microscopic fragments into an unshakable case against a criminology student who studied detection but couldn't escape it.
